Weddings
Everyone will give you advice on how to do your wedding. Here's my advice as an Event Planner. Sit down with your fiance and decide what is most important to both of you for the ceremony and the reception. Make sure you handle those particulars yourself. Then decide what you don't mind delegating to either family. Ask them if they want to participate. If so, let them. Give them guidelines and then let them go with it. Too many people try to either control everything or let everything be done for them. I find that the couple needs to have control around the things that they care about and needs to relinquish some control on areas that they don't.

Another tip I would give is to be open to compromise. There is always more than one way to do something. If his family wants an open bar but your family doesn't, go the middle ground. Have an open bar for the first hour, or let his family provide wine at each table for during the meal. Make it work.

These tips go for working with an Event Planner as well. Just because you hire an Event Planner doesn't mean you are not involved with the planning. Planning a Dinner Party
Dinner parties are great fun to plan. You can pick a theme or just get a group together to cook a meal. Whether you invite a few close friends or neighbors, it's the special details that make the evening. I recommend choosing different wines to be tasted with the courses. If you don't have time to do everything, invite everyone to bring an appetizer to share and ask a couple people to help with the meal part. Children's Birthday Parties
Children's parties are so much fun to plan. However, they can also be difficult with the pressure to make your child's party more fantastic than the rest. I believe that parties should be simple and filled with lots of age appropriate activities. One thing I do is to pick a theme and use the theme throughout the party. Then I make sure that I have enough parents to help with games, passing out cake and goodies bags, etc.

I go to my local library to pick up some party books with ideas. One or two ideas goes a long way. I also go to a craft store such as A.C. Moore and see what craft ideas they have. These are usually in kits and are inexpensive to do. Each child makes something and takes it home.
